摘要
This study allowed to identify several land-use conflicts in the Volturno River Coastal Zone area which extends for about 50 km2 on-land and seaward. The study area was analysed via Environmental Function Analysis involving assessment of specific environmental and socio-economic indicators. These were allocated scores from field surveys, interviews and extensive desktop studies, which included literature data and public territorial geo-databases. Normalised scores allowed production of a conservation/development matrix, enabling to evaluate the potential for conservation, development or conflict fields. The main conflicts were strictly related to urbanization, land reclamation and conservation of pristine areas with increasing anthropic pressure. The study site resulted to be in the conservation/development full conflict field of the matrix, signifying a tendency to high conflict rather than conservation as one might expect. This demonstrated that despite the strong attempt to preserve a pristine environment, the presence of different conflicts of use can hinder both the potential of development and the conservation of the area preventing either to take place. This important result leads to suggest that Environmental Function Analysis may be a potential tool for forthcoming adaptive management strategies in the study area.
